🎉🥳👏 SEOArena’s Partners Achieve $100M+ in sales. Don’t miss out, join Today. 🎉🥳👏

3 Ways to Optimize for Semantic Search

by | May 13, 2022 | Technical SEO | 0 comments

Learn how to optimize your website for the latest search engines using these Ways to Optimize for Semantic Search! Semantic search is a search technology that utilizes the meaning of a query to deliver the most relevant results. Unlike traditional keyword-based search engines, semantic search takes into account the context of a query and the relationships between the terms used in the query and the documents being searched, in order to provide a more accurate and relevant search result.

Semantic search is based on the idea that a word or a phrase doesn’t have a fixed meaning, and the meaning of a word can change depending on the context in which it is used. By analyzing the context and relationships between words, semantic search can understand the intent behind a query and return results that are relevant to the user’s needs.

This technology has revolutionized the way people search for information online and has improved the user experience by providing more accurate and relevant search results. It also has many practical applications, including information retrieval, question answering systems, and recommendation systems.

3 Ways to Optimize for Semantic Search

As the world of search engines and search algorithms continues to evolve, the way that we think about optimization has changed. Semantic search is a buzzword that has been thrown around a lot in recent years, and for good reason. Essentially, semantic search is all about understanding the true meaning behind a user’s search query and returning the most relevant results. Rather than simply matching keywords, semantic search aims to understand the context and intent behind a search.

For businesses looking to improve their SEO, understanding and optimizing for semantic search is becoming increasingly important. Here are three key ways that you can optimize your website to take advantage of semantic search.

Focus on Natural Language and Conversational Queries

As search engines become better at understanding natural language and conversational queries, it’s becoming increasingly important for businesses to optimize their content accordingly. Instead of simply focusing on specific keywords, businesses need to create content that matches the way people naturally ask questions.

This means that instead of stuffing your content with exact-match keywords, you should be writing in a more conversational tone. Consider the types of questions that your audience is likely to be asking, and write content that provides clear and concise answers.

For example, if you run a restaurant, your customers might be searching for information about your menu. Instead of simply listing out your menu items, you could create a page that provides detailed descriptions of each dish, including the ingredients and the cooking process. This would help to answer your customers’ questions and provide valuable information that can help them make an informed decision.

Use Structured Data to Help Search Engines Understand Your Content

Structured data is a way of adding additional context to your website’s content, making it easier for search engines to understand what your site is all about. By using structured data, you can help search engines to understand the relationship between different pieces of content on your site and provide more relevant results to users.

For example, you might use structured data to tell search engines that a particular page on your site is a recipe. By doing so, search engines can provide additional information in search results, such as the cooking time and nutritional information. This can help to make your content more appealing to users and improve your click-through rates.

There are a number of different types of structured data that you can use, including Schema.org markup and JSON-LD. The important thing is to ensure that you’re using structured data consistently across your site and that you’re providing accurate and useful information to search engines.

Focus on High-Quality, Authoritative Content

Finally, it’s important to remember that while semantic search is all about understanding the context and intent behind a user’s search query, the most important factor in determining your search rankings is still the quality of your content.

In order to rank highly in search results, you need to be creating high-quality, authoritative content that provides real value to your users. This means creating content that is well-researched, informative, and engaging. You should also be aiming to establish yourself as an authority in your industry, by regularly publishing content that is of interest to your target audience.

One effective way to do this is to create a blog on your website and regularly publish content that provides valuable information to your readers. By doing so, you can establish yourself as a thought leader in your industry and improve your overall visibility in search results.

Ways To Use Semantic SEO For Higher Rankings

Semantic SEO has become an increasingly important strategy in improving search engine rankings. Semantic SEO refers to the practice of using language and meaning to optimize your content for search engines. By understanding how search engines interpret language, you can create content that is more relevant and useful to users, and ultimately achieve higher rankings.

In this article, we’ll explore some of the ways you can use semantic SEO to improve your search engine rankings.

Conduct Keyword Research

Keyword research is the foundation of any SEO strategy, and it’s just as important for semantic SEO. By conducting keyword research, you can identify the language that your target audience uses to search for products or services in your industry.

There are several tools you can use for keyword research, including Google Keyword Planner and Ahrefs. These tools can help you find long-tail keywords, which are more specific and have lower search volume, but can be easier to rank for.

When conducting keyword research for semantic SEO, it’s important to consider the context in which the keyword is used. For example, if you’re targeting the keyword “SEO,” you’ll need to consider the various contexts in which the term is used, such as “SEO tools,” “SEO tips,” and “SEO strategies.”

Optimize for Semantic Keywords

Once you’ve identified your target keywords, you can start optimizing your content for semantic keywords. Semantic keywords are related to your target keyword and can help search engines understand the context of your content.

For example, if your target keyword is “SEO,” your semantic keywords might include “search engine optimization,” “SEO techniques,” and “SEO services.”

To optimize for semantic keywords, include them in your content in a natural way. Avoid keyword stuffing, which can result in a penalty from search engines. Instead, focus on creating high-quality, valuable content that includes your target and semantic keywords.

Use Structured Data

Structured data is a type of markup language that helps search engines understand the content of your website. By using structured data, you can provide additional information about your content, such as the type of content, the author, and the date of publication.

Structured data can also help your content appear in featured snippets, which are a prominent position on the search engine results page (SERP) that can drive more traffic to your website.

To use structured data, you can use a tool like Schema.org to create markup for your content. This markup can be added to your website’s HTML code to provide additional information to search engines.

Optimize for User Intent

User intent is the reason why a user is searching for a particular keyword. By understanding user intent, you can create content that is more relevant and useful to your target audience.

There are three types of user intent: informational, navigational, and transactional. Informational intent is when a user is searching for information, navigational intent is when a user is searching for a specific website or page, and transactional intent is when a user is searching for a product or service to purchase.

To optimize for user intent, create content that answers the questions that your target audience is asking. Use long-tail keywords to target informational intent, optimize your website’s navigation to target navigational intent, and create product pages and landing pages to target transactional intent.

Use Latent Semantic Indexing (LSI)

Latent Semantic Indexing (LSI) is a mathematical algorithm used by search engines to identify the relationships between words and phrases. By using LSI, search engines can understand the context of your content and rank it accordingly.

To use LSI, include related words and phrases in your content. For example, if you’re writing about “SEO,” you might include related words like “Google,” “search engine,” “ranking,” and “keywords.”

How Semantic SEO Improves The Search Experience

With the continuous growth of the internet, it has become essential for businesses to have a strong online presence. The primary goal of a business is to have their website show up on the first page of search engine results, as this is where the majority of the clicks occur. In recent years, there has been a shift in the way search engines operate, and this has led to the development of semantic SEO. Semantic SEO is a technique that utilizes the natural language processing and understanding of the user’s intent to optimize search results.

How Does Semantic SEO Improve the Search Experience?

Semantic SEO has a significant impact on the search experience. Here are some of the ways it improves the search experience:

Provides More Accurate Results

With semantic SEO, search engines can better understand the context and meaning of a search query. This means that the search engine can provide more accurate results that match the user’s intent. For example, if a user searches for “best pizza restaurants,” Semantic SEO can understand that the user is looking for recommendations for pizza restaurants in their area. It can then provide relevant results that match the user’s intent.

Delivers Better User Experience

One of the primary benefits of semantic SEO is that it improves the user experience. By providing more accurate results, users are more likely to find what they are looking for on the first page of search engine results. This means that they don’t have to spend as much time clicking through pages of irrelevant results, which improves their experience.

Matches User Intent

Semantic SEO matches the user’s intent by analyzing the context and meaning of the search query. This means that it can provide more targeted results that match the user’s intent. For example, if a user searches for “best pizza restaurants,” semantic SEO can understand that the user is looking for recommendations for pizza restaurants in their area. It can then provide relevant results that match the user’s intent.

Increases Click-Through Rate

By providing more accurate and relevant results, semantic SEO can increase the click-through rate of search engine results. This is because users are more likely to click on results that match their intent, which improves their experience.

Provides Richer Content

Semantic SEO also enables search engines to provide richer content in search results. This includes things like featured snippets, knowledge graphs, and other types of rich content that can improve the user experience. For example, if a user searches for “how to make pizza,” semantic SEO can provide a step-by-step guide on how to make pizza directly in the search results.

Increases Brand Visibility

By optimizing web pages and content for semantic SEO, businesses can increase their visibility in search results. This means that they are more likely to show up on the first page of search engine results, which increases their brand visibility.


In conclusion, semantic SEO is a technique that utilizes natural language processing and understanding of the user’s intent to optimize search results. It has become a necessity for businesses looking to improve their online visibility and provide a better search experience. By providing more accurate results, delivering a better user experience, matching user intent, increasing click-through rate, providing richer content

Optimizing for semantic search is becoming increasingly important for businesses looking to improve their SEO. By focusing on natural language and conversational queries, using structured data to help search engines understand your content, and creating high-quality, authoritative content, you can improve your visibility in search results and provide more value to your customers.